Belgium tightens rules: corona pass in catering, mouth caps return

In Belgium, a corona ticket must be shown in the entire catering industry from Monday. In addition, Belgians must again wear face masks in public indoor spaces from Friday, Prime Minister De Croo announced in a press conference about the rising corona figures in the country.

De Croo spoke of “an autumn wave” that makes it necessary to tighten up the corona rules, which will apply for at least three months. The obligation to show a corona pass in the catering industry already applied in Brussels. Wallonia had previously agreed to the measure from 1 November, which will therefore also apply in the Flemish catering industry, the broadcaster writes. GARDEN. The pass must also be shown in gyms.

Staff of catering and fitness centers are also required to wear a face mask.

‘Severe measures not necessary’

“The moment we are again flooded by infections, we have to erect higher protection walls,” said De Croo. He also called on Belgians to work from home as much as possible again. Stricter measures are not necessary, according to him, because about 85 percent of Belgians are fully vaccinated.

De Croo: “Last year we would have shut down certain things in the same situation. Now we keep everything open.”

The number of infections in Belgium increased by 75 percent last week, with an average of about 5300 new infections per day. The number of hospital admissions increased by 69 percent (102 admissions per day).
